Transaction 76703a91fbd4b57e06e3c61399785c9519de350d72570add87b8cb85a3291f89

3 Input
1 Outputs
  • 76703a91fbd4b57e06e3c61399785c9519de350d72570add87b8cb85a3291f89:0
  • value  109690000
    address  3BMEXJh2YXq2ZPkWpVE67VDG9oYMTMVV9Q